Where does “luxus” come from?
luxus (Latin) comes from Proto-Italic louksos, from Proto-Indo-European lewg-so-s, from Proto-Indo-European lewg- — to bend.
luxus (Latin): dislocated; a dislocation; extravagance, luxury,...
